Relative Search:
Baidu Google
Edit this listing

Pavilion on Franklin

121 S Estes Dr
Chapel Hill , NC 27514
919-932-5800
Category

Driving Directions

From:
To: 121 S Estes Dr ,Chapel Hill , NC 27514